International audienceSolving large sparse linear systems is a time-consuming step in basin modeling or reservoir simulation. The choice of a robust preconditioner strongly impact the performance of the overall simulation. Heterogeneous architectures based on General Purpose computing on Graphic Processing Units (GPGPU) or many-core architectures introduce programming challenges which can be managed in a transparent way for developer with the use of runtime systems. Nevertheless, algorithms need to be well suited for these massively parallel architectures. In this paper, we present preconditioning techniques which enable to take advantage of emerging architectures. We also present our task-based implementations through the use of the HARTS ...
The evolution of High-Performance Computing systems has taken asharp turn in the last decade. Due to...
International audienceDomain decomposition methods are, alongside multigrid methods, one of the domi...
The simulation is a primary step on the evaluation process of modern networked systems. The scalabil...
International audienceSolving large sparse linear systems is a time-consuming step in basin modeling...
Solving large sparse linear systems is a time-consuming step in basin modeling or reservoir simulati...
Les méthodes en simulation numérique dans le domaine de l’ingénierie pétrolière nécessitent la résol...
Numerical methods in reservoir engineering simulations lead to the resolution of unstructured, large...
Numerical methods in reservoir engineering simulations lead to the resolution of unstructured, large...
La simulation est une étape primordiale dans l'évolution des systèmes en réseaux. L’évolutivité et l...
La résolution de grands systèmes linéaires creux est un élément essentiel des simulations numériques...
Large-scale scientific applications and industrial simulations are nowadays fully integrated in many...
This thesis introduces a unified framework for various domain decomposition methods:those with overl...
Cette thèse traite d’une nouvelle classe de préconditionneurs qui ont pour but d’accélérer la résolu...
La simulation multi-agent représente une solution pertinente pour l’ingénierie et l’étude des systèm...
Cette thèse présente une vision unifiée de plusieurs méthodes de décomposition de domaine : celles a...
The evolution of High-Performance Computing systems has taken asharp turn in the last decade. Due to...
International audienceDomain decomposition methods are, alongside multigrid methods, one of the domi...
The simulation is a primary step on the evaluation process of modern networked systems. The scalabil...
International audienceSolving large sparse linear systems is a time-consuming step in basin modeling...
Solving large sparse linear systems is a time-consuming step in basin modeling or reservoir simulati...
Les méthodes en simulation numérique dans le domaine de l’ingénierie pétrolière nécessitent la résol...
Numerical methods in reservoir engineering simulations lead to the resolution of unstructured, large...
Numerical methods in reservoir engineering simulations lead to the resolution of unstructured, large...
La simulation est une étape primordiale dans l'évolution des systèmes en réseaux. L’évolutivité et l...
La résolution de grands systèmes linéaires creux est un élément essentiel des simulations numériques...
Large-scale scientific applications and industrial simulations are nowadays fully integrated in many...
This thesis introduces a unified framework for various domain decomposition methods:those with overl...
Cette thèse traite d’une nouvelle classe de préconditionneurs qui ont pour but d’accélérer la résolu...
La simulation multi-agent représente une solution pertinente pour l’ingénierie et l’étude des systèm...
Cette thèse présente une vision unifiée de plusieurs méthodes de décomposition de domaine : celles a...
The evolution of High-Performance Computing systems has taken asharp turn in the last decade. Due to...
International audienceDomain decomposition methods are, alongside multigrid methods, one of the domi...
The simulation is a primary step on the evaluation process of modern networked systems. The scalabil...